You can check a car seat for free with Jetblue and it will not count against your luggage allowance of one free checked bag per person. We always gate check our stroller, which is also free. I don't know the policy for checking a stroller at check-in.
 
We flew JetBlue to NYC a few years ago and loved it. We were able to check our stroller for free with no problem. We also got our seat asignments as we requested. The seats are larger and all have free tv. Be sure to bring headphones. Our kids watched Disney channel and Cartoon network all the way there. I watched HGTV and my husband watched ESPN. JetBlue still provides free drinks and snacks unlike many other airlines. I will fly JetBlue any chance I get.

We've flown 2 times Jetblue with our now 3 year old.. we are flying again the end of the month.. the TV's are a savior on the flights.. we have gate checked and luggage checked our stollers.. this time we are bringing car seat and stroller I will gate check both.. either way free of charge!

Just be careful at Disney when we did flight check in at the resort the counted our stroller as a piece of luggage... we had an extra free one anyways but be careful!

Great prices we are flying on Jetblue credit from December. 89&99 are great prices. The $99 may drop to $89 and you can get credit. They used to go $59 $79 but I have not seen that in a long time. Set up an alert at yapta.com and they will email you when price drops. Your gonna love jetblue!
